A tool for checking which AI models are available through GitHub Copilot and what each model supports. GitHub Copilot is an AI coding service built into developer tools.

In plain words
What is it for?
Use it to list available Copilot models, inspect context limits and capabilities, and filter models by vendor, family, or feature.
Why use it?
It avoids relying on outdated model lists or assumptions about what your account can use.

GitHub Copilot Models Query

Query available GitHub Copilot AI models directly from the API to see what models you actually have access to (not just what OpenCode knows about).

Usage

Quick Query

Use the provided script to fetch your available models:

# From project root
.opencode/skills/github-copilot-models/scripts/fetch-models.sh

# With JSON output for parsing
.opencode/skills/github-copilot-models/scripts/fetch-models.sh --json

# Filter by category
.opencode/skills/github-copilot-models/scripts/fetch-models.sh --category powerful

# Show only picker-enabled models
.opencode/skills/github-copilot-models/scripts/fetch-models.sh --picker-only

Script Options

| --json | Raw JSON output | fetch-models.sh --json | | --picker-only | Only show featured models | fetch-models.sh --picker-only | | --category <cat> | Filter by category | fetch-models.sh --category versatile | | --family <name> | Filter by model family | fetch-models.sh --family claude | | --vendor <name> | Filter by vendor | fetch-models.sh --vendor Anthropic | | --vision | Only models with vision | fetch-models.sh --vision | | --help | Show all options | fetch-models.sh --help |

Manual API Query

# Get auth token from OpenCode config
AUTH_TOKEN=$(jq -r '.["github-copilot"].access' ~/.local/share/opencode/auth.json)

# Query GitHub Copilot API
curl -s -H "Authorization: Bearer $AUTH_TOKEN" \
  "https://api.githubcopilot.com/models" | jq .

Authentication

The script automatically reads your OpenCode authentication from:

~/.local/share/opencode/auth.json

If authentication fails:

# Re-authenticate with GitHub Copilot
opencode auth add github-copilot

# Verify authentication
opencode auth list
